A circuit is constructed with five resistors and a battery as shown. The values for the resistors are: R1 = R5 = 58 , R2 = 104 , R3 = 110 , and R4 = 62 . The battery voltage is V = 12 V.
What is Rab, the equivalent resistance between points a and b?
What is Rac, the equivalent resistance between points a and c?
What is I5, the current that flows through resistor R5?
What is I2, the current that flows through resistor R2?
What is I1, the current that flows through the resistor R1?
What is V4, the voltage across resistor R4?
Explanation / Answer
Here ,
for the resistance between a and b
Rab = (R2 + R3) || R4
Rab = (104 + 110) * 62/( 62 + 104 + 110)
Rab = 48.1 Ohm
resistance between a and b is 48.1 Ohm
-----------------------------------
for Rac
Rac = R1 + Rab
Rac = 48.1 + 58
Rac = 106.1 Ohm
the resistance between a and c is 106.1 ohm
-------------------------------
total resistance , Req = 106.1 + 58
Req = 164.1 Ohm
current in R5 = V/Req
current in R5 = 12/164.1
current in R5 = 0.073 A
------------------------
curernt in R2 = current in R5 * R4/(R4 + R2 + R3)
curernt in R2 = 0.073 * 62/( 62 + 104 + 110)
current in R2 = 0.0164 A
------------------------
current through R1 = current in R5
current through R1 = 0.073 A
---------------------------
for the voltage across R4
voltage across R4 = (0.0164) * (104 + 110)
voltage across R4 = 3.515 V
